Clean, safe drinking water is essential. Backflow prevention plays a critical role in preserving water quality by preventing contaminants from siphoning or being pumped back into the municipal water supply. Municipalities often require annual testing and detailed documentation for backflow assemblies—failing to comply can lead to fines, public health risks, or service interruptions. Backflow Repair Process
Diagnose
Identify the failure cause—worn seals, mineral buildup, valve seat damage, or alignment issues.
Quote
Provide a transparent, written repair estimate including parts and labor.
Repair & Test
Execute repairs using OEM-equivalent parts, then re-test to verify performance.
Report
Supply updated documentation for municipal compliance.

Who Needs These Services?
Homeowners with irrigation systems, boilers, pools, or other cross-connection risks.
Property managers and HOAs responsible for multi-unit water systems and compliance.
Commercial facilities with backflow assemblies for boilers, HVAC systems, fire lines, or process water.
Construction contractors requiring installation and commissioning of backflow prevention devices.
